从入门到精通,学习编程,从入门到精通
请提供您想要生成摘要的内容。

在互联网的洪流中,网站插件代码的开发已经成为提升用户体验和增强网站功能的重要手段,无论是博客、电商网站还是个人网站,插件的加入都能让网站更加丰富多彩,本文旨在为零基础的开发者提供详尽指南,帮助您一步步学会如何 *** 网站插件代码。
一、基础知识与工具准备
*** 网站插件代码的之一步就是学习相关的基础知识,你需要了解HTML、CSS以及J*aScript的基础知识,为了更高效地完成插件的开发,我们推荐使用Visual Studio Code、Sublime Text或Atom等代码编辑器,并安装Node.js作为运行环境,在开始之前,建议熟悉前端框架如React、Vue或Angular,因为这些框架提供了丰富的组件化和状态管理工具,能够大大简化插件开发流程。
二、插件的基本架构设计
一个成功的插件需要具备一定的设计思路,首先明确插件的核心功能是什么?它应该解决什么问题?然后规划插件的结构,一般而言,插件包含以下主要部分:HTML模板(负责展示)、CSS样式(实现视觉效果)、J*aScript逻辑(处理交互)和配置选项(允许用户自定义设置),根据需求的不同,可以进一步细化各个模块。
三、编写插件代码
1、创建项目目录:在您的开发环境中创建一个新的文件夹,用于存放整个项目的源代码,初始化一个Git仓库并克隆下来,这样不仅可以方便版本控制,还能更好地与他人协作。
2、HTML模板:这是插件最直观的部分,通常包括一些基本的标签和结构,使用模板引擎如E *** 、Handlebars等来动态生成页面内容,提高可维护性,对于博客插件,可能需要渲染文章列表和单篇文章详情。
3、CSS样式:CSS是美化网页的关键,通过合理的布局和配色方案,使插件界面既美观又实用,建议使用响应式设计确保不同设备上的良好显示效果,对于博客插件,可以设计简洁明了的文章卡片。
4、J*aScript逻辑:这是插件的核心部分,负责实现所有交互功能,利用J*aScript的DOM操作和事件监听机制,可以轻松实现页面的动态变化,添加点击事件监听器以加载更多文章、搜索功能等,考虑到SEO优化,可以在J*aScript中集成必要的搜索引擎友好元数据。
5、配置选项:为了让用户可以根据自身需求自定义插件,可以添加配置选项供用户调整,常见的配置项包括主题颜色、字体大小等,使用 *** ON对象存储配置信息,并在用户首次启用插件时提示进行设置。
四、调试与测试
在编写完插件代码后,需要进行仔细的调试以确保其正常运行,可以使用浏览器的开发者工具进行性能分析和错误追踪,通过单元测试、集成测试等 *** 来验证插件的各项功能是否按预期工作,确保在各种场景下插件都能稳定可靠地运作。
五、部署与发布
完成调试后,将插件打包成可部署的形式,使用npm或yarn构建包,以便后续上传至GitHub或其他代码托管平台,配置好部署脚本,包括编译、打包以及部署到目标服务器或静态网站托管服务(如GitHub Pages、Netlify等)的过程。
最后一步是发布插件,通过GitHub等开源社区发布插件可以吸引更多的用户和贡献者,扩大影响力,发布时附带详细的文档说明,指导如何安装和使用,积极回应用户反馈,及时修复已知问题,不断改进和完善插件。
*** 网站插件是一项既具挑战性又充满乐趣的任务,通过不断学习和实践,你将逐步掌握这一技能,希望本文能为你打开一扇通往插件开发的大门,让你在未来的开发之路上越走越远。
相关文章
- 江西网站建设概述,江西网站建设概述,江西网站建设,全面介绍与分析
- 探索 *** *的兴起与发展趋势,揭秘 *** *的兴起与发展,趋势分析, *** *的兴起与发展,趋势解析
- 灵宝网站 *** 工作室的优势与特点,灵宝网站 *** 工作室的独特优势和特色概述,灵宝网站 *** 工作室,独树一帜的创新技术与服务优势
- 南昌网站 *** 公司的优势和特点,南昌专业网站 *** 公司为您带来优质服务与高效技术,南昌专业网站 *** 公司,提供优质服务与高效技术
- 利用自动生成网站地图的工具提升网站搜索引擎优化,使用自助创建网站地图工具促进网站搜索引擎优化提升,如何使用自助创建网站地图工具提高网站搜索引擎优化
- ASP在线生成网站地图源代码的简便 *** ,快速生成ASP网站地图,简单易用的 ***
- 如何提交网站地图到百度?,如何在百度上创建网站地图并提交?,如何在百度上创建和提交网站地图?
- 南昌网站优化公司,提升企业品牌形象,南昌专业网站优化公司助力企业品牌形象提升,南昌网站优化公司,提升企业品牌形象的关键所在
- 网站建设更便宜,网站建设的经济选项,更低成本解决方案,网站建设更低成本方案,经济实惠的选择
- 什么是HTML网站地图?,什么是HTML网站地图?
